    Single-carrier Incremental Relaying with Joint Tx/Rx FDE

    No full text
    Abstract—We propose an incremental relaying scheme using joint Tx/Rx frequency-domain equalization (FDE) for singlecarrier (SC) transmission. If a packet sent by a source node (S) has been correctly decoded at a relay node (R), but not at the destination node (D), retransmission is cooperatively done by S and R. Assuming that the channel state information (CSI) is shared by S, R, and D, joint Tx/Rx FDE is performed. We derive a set of optimal/suboptimal Tx/Rx FDE weights among S, R, and D, based on the minimum mean square error (MMSE) criterion under total transmit power constraint of S and R. Computer simulation verifies the effectiveness of the proposed scheme. Keywords-component; Single-carrier, cooperative relay, hybrid ARQ, frequency-domain equalization I
